A rigid tank contains 1 kg of oxygen \(\left(\mathrm{O}_{2}\right) \text { at } p_{1}=40 \mathrm{bar}\), \(T_{1}=180 \mathrm{~K}\). The gas is cooled until the temperature drops to 150 K. Determine the volume of the tank, in m3, and the final pressure, in bar, using the

(a) ideal gas equation of state.

(b) Redlich–Kwong equation.

(c) compressibility chart.
